The Revolt of Job (1983)

The Revolt of Job (1983) poster

The story of a childless Jewish couple in WWII-era Hungary who adopt a Hungarian boy and raise him with their values and traditions.

Director: Imre Gyöngyössy, Barna Kabay
Genre: Drama
Runtime: 98 min
